Duties and Responsibilities
- Receiving and processing voter registration applications
- Receiving felony notices, death notices, cancellations from other states and removing these voters from the electors list
- Holding hearings as necessary to challenge the right of persons to remain on the electors list
- Issuing absentee ballots
- Responsible for advanced voting
- Working closely with Election Superintendent in the reapportionment process
- Working with local groups in coordinating local registration drives
- Entering credit for voting
- Maintaining and ordering electors lists for use by Election Superintendent
- Determining and placing elector in proper Congressional, Senate, house and local districts and mailing precinct cards to all electors
- Providing municipal registrars with municipality's electors list
- Maintaining current voter registration applications; as well as maintaining deleted registrations for at least two years
The County Board of Registrars consist of three electors appointed for four year terms by the Judge of Superior Court. The Board of Registrars is required to meet once a month to transact the business of the Board and can meet at other times as required by the Chief Registrar.
